About Annie
I’m a professionally trained actor and freelance scriptwriter in my 20s, living in London. I graduated with a 2:1 BA (Hons) in Acting & Performance from the University for the Creative Arts, and I still clearly remember how overwhelming the journey into drama school and higher education can feel.
Pursuing a creative path is exciting, but it’s also deeply personal. You’re not just submitting an application — you’re standing in front of a panel and sharing something of yourself, often in just a few minutes. I’ve been through that process myself, and I understand the pressure, self-doubt and vulnerability that can come with it.
Because of that, I approach my teaching with empathy and honesty. My aim is to create a calm, supportive space where students feel safe to take risks, ask questions and grow in confidence. I’m reliable, professional and fully committed to helping each student feel prepared — not just technically, but mentally — for the next step in their training.

My approach to tutoring is practical, focused and centred around each individual student. I work primarily with ages 16–22, particularly those preparing for university or drama school auditions.
No two students are the same, and I adapt every lesson to suit the individual’s strengths, challenges and working style. I’m particularly interested in helping students identify what makes them unique as performers — their instincts, quirks and natural qualities — and developing those into confident, truthful performances rather than trying to mould them into a single “type” of actor.
Lessons are usually 60–90 minutes, depending on the student’s needs. Sessions often include text analysis, character exploration, voice and physicality work, and detailed feedback on monologues or audition pieces. We break down characters and text carefully, explore objectives and intentions, and build authenticity and clarity in performance.
I hold a 2:1 BA (Hons) in Acting & Performance from the University for the Creative Arts and currently work as a freelance writer and Assistant Director. This allows me to approach performance from both the actor’s and the creative team’s perspective, helping students understand not only how to perform a piece, but how it functions within the wider production.
